Create data protection standard
A data protection standard creates a primary layer of protection for similar types of data by masking the data wherever it is stored.
When creating a data protection standard, you can do one of the following:
- Create a draft of the standard. This action doesn't start the synchronization (sync), allowing you to work on the standard later. The sync status of a draft standard is Draft.
- Publish the standard. This action starts the sync, sending the standard to the source. The sync status of a published standard is initially Pending, and it changes to Active if the sync is successful.
Prerequisites
- You have a global role that has the Protect > Edit or Protect > Administration global permission.
- You have the Catalog global role. This role is required to view data classifications for selection in a data protection standard.
- Protectgroups are created.
